Jim's Creek Savanna Restoration Project
The proposal is the restoration of a 500 acre area to pre-settlement open forest conditions, of ponderosa pine, Douglas-fir, and Oregon white oak savanna.
Project Summary
Location Summary:
About 16 miles south of the City of Oakridge, between FS Road 21 and 2129.
